Trinity County Resource Conservation District is accepting applications for the position of Project Specialist – Horticulture in its Ecology Program. This position will assist with nursery management and operations, landscape and grounds maintenance, and community outreach and engagement. In addition to overseeing the nursery, this position will coordinate general landscaping and stewardship needs for the Young Family Ranch and assist with District events. This is a full-time supervisory position with pay of $28.00 per hour. This is a grant-funded position for one year, with the opportunity to extend employment as funding allows. The position has flexible scheduling, paid leave, medical benefits, and retirement options. Review of applications will take place on December 1, 2025; anticipated start date is January 12, 2026.
